On the day of departure if a first class cabin is really empty the self service kiosks will offer upgrades for $45 up to $150 roughly. That should have confirmed him in first class and given him a seat assignment. Another type of upgrade would be a miles based one. $35 dollars for every 500 miles, but that only puts enough miles into your account to standby for an upgrade.

Either way, both of those are really easy to refund. Just look in the record, see that he wasn't boarded in first class, then refund the transaction. Sorry for your loss.
